  1. /*
  2. * Copyright (C) 2010 Michael Neuling IBM Corporation
  3. *
  4. * Driver for the pseries hardware RNG for POWER7+ and above
  5. *
  6. * This program is free software; you can redistribute it and/or modify
  7. * it under the terms of the GNU General Public License version 2 as
  8. * published by the Free Software Foundation.
  9. *
  10. * This program is distributed in the hope that it will be useful,
  11. * but WITHOUT ANY WARRANTY; without even the implied warranty of
  12. * M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E. See the
  13. * GNU General Public License for more details.
  14. *
  15. * You should have received a copy of the GNU General Public License
  16. * along with this program; if not, write to the Free Software
  17. * Foundation, Inc., 59 Temple Place, Suite 330, Boston, MA 02111-1307 USA
  18. */
  19. #include <linux/module.h>
  20. #include <linux/hw_random.h>
  21. #include <asm/vio.h>
  22. #define MODULE_NAME "pseries-rng"
  23. static int pseries_rng_data_read(struct hwrng *rng, u32 *data)
  24. {
  25. if (plpar_hcall(H_RANDOM, (unsigned long *)data) != H_SUCCESS) {
  26. printk(KERN_ERR "pseries rng hcall error\n");
  27. return 0;
  28. }
  29. return 8;
  30. }
  31. /**
  32. * pseries_rng_get_desired_dma - Return desired DMA allocate for CMO operations
  33. *
  34. * This is a required function for a driver to operate in a CMO environment
  35. * but this device does not make use of DMA allocations, return 0.
  36. *
  37. * Return value:
  38. * Number of bytes of IO data the driver will need to perform well -> 0
  39. */
  40. static unsigned long pseries_rng_get_desired_dma(struct vio_dev *vdev)
  41. {
  42. return 0;
  43. };
  44. static struct hwrng pseries_rng = {
  45. .name = MODULE_NAME,
  46. .data_read = pseries_rng_data_read,
  47. };
  48. static int __init pseries_rng_probe(struct vio_dev *dev,
  49. const struct vio_device_id *id)
  50. {
  51. return hwrng_register(&pseries_rng);
  52. }
  53. static int __exit pseries_rng_remove(struct vio_dev *dev)
  54. {
  55. hwrng_unregister(&pseries_rng);
  56. return 0;
  57. }
  58. static struct vio_device_id pseries_rng_driver_ids[] = {
  59. { "ibm,random-v1", "ibm,random"},
  60. { "", "" }
  61. };
  62. MODULE_DEVICE_TABLE(vio, pseries_rng_driver_ids);
  63. static struct vio_driver pseries_rng_driver = {
  64. .name = MODULE_NAME,
  65. .probe = pseries_rng_probe,
  66. .remove = pseries_rng_remove,
  67. .get_desired_dma = pseries_rng_get_desired_dma,
  68. .id_table = pseries_rng_driver_ids
  69. };
  70. static int __init rng_init(void)
  71. {
  72. printk(KERN_INFO "Registering IBM pSeries RNG driver\n");
  73. return vio_register_driver(&pseries_rng_driver);
  74. }
  75. module_init(rng_init);
  76. static void __exit rng_exit(void)
  77. {
  78. vio_unregister_driver(&pseries_rng_driver);
  79. }
  80. module_exit(rng_exit);
  81. MODULE_LICENSE("GPL");
  82. MODULE_AUTHOR("Michael Neuling <mikey@neuling.org>");
  83. MODULE_DESCRIPTION("H/W RNG driver for IBM pSeries processors");
